About UsDavid Butcher of Road Runner Services

Road Runner Wrecker Service, Inc. was started by 22-year old David Butcher in 1992. Already a seasoned tow truck driver, David decided he wanted to be in business for himself. The main office of Road Runner Wrecker Service is located in busy Sterling, Virginia, with a secondary location in Culpeper County. Road Runner Wrecker Service concentrates on working with insurance companies, municipalities, construction companies, police agencies, private property customers, as well as towing for the general public. With its wide range of services and expertise, Road Runner can tow and/or recover any type and size of vehicle and also perform short and long distance transport of construction equipment.

The company motto is "Dedicated, Professional Service," and its stated goal is to provide quality service from the initial phone call to its professional dispatching staff, to the servicing of the vehicle or equipment by trained and knowledgeable drivers, and finally to its streamlined billing system. The fleet includes heavy duty wreckers, Landolls, lowboys, four-car carriers, various light duty wreckers and flatbeds, and an air cushion recovery unit with trailer.

Road Runner has a full time staff of over 30 employees. Part of our success has been from being surrounded by these successful people. Our future plans are to continue to grow from referrals by doing a good job for current customers.
